草庐IT

html - HTML 5 中是不是不需要像 HTML 那样关闭标签?

在HTML5中不是必须像HTML一样关闭标签吗?或者它是W3C验证器中的错误为什么这段代码在W3C验证器中有效titleSomeText如果它在HTML5中真的有效,我会感到惊讶。但是保持这种行为在HTML5中有效有什么好处吗?HTML5的创建者是否认为更严格的XHTML规则对Web不利? 最佳答案 该标记确实有效。tagsdon'thavetobeclosedinHTML4.01orHTML5.我不确定您是从哪里得到的HTML5要求像XHTML中那样关闭所有内容的想法。HTML5只是具有额外新功能的常规HTML(因此版本从4.01

jquery - 一个大的html表格是不是不可能装进一个小空间?

对此显而易见的答案是“这不可能”或“让数据更小”...我已经尝试过这些但它们不洗所以我需要想出一个替代方案网页上有一个表格,其中有14列。其中2列的文本很长(但不能换行-每行的文本必须全部在一行上)。不用说,大约在第9列之后,表格就从屏幕右侧消失了!那么,谁能想出一个神奇的解决方案,让这张table完全适合屏幕?错误的答案:减少数据量允许行中的文本换行到第二行“这是不可能完成的”-是的,我知道,但是某个地方的人会有天才的答案,或者一些神奇的jQuery库可以做这种事情很有趣,但需要更多信息:将所有列压缩到足以容纳表格,然后溢出的数据可以在展开列时查看例如:|这是我的数据,但它...|

html - 使用 html 类属性作为 javascript 句柄是不好的做法吗

我经常需要使用jquery一次选择多个元素...为此,我通常只需将一个类添加到我想要选择的所有元素,然后使用jquery按类选择。这是一种不好的做法还是我应该改用html5数据属性之类的东西? 最佳答案 我认为对于不需要传递参数的一般引用来说是可以的。即所有.flashing元素都将应用闪光效果。结束。当您开始使用多个类或“数据类”时,它会失控,例如class="flashing-15timesonhoveronly"等...一旦您需要开始传递参数或变量,您应该转向数据属性或其他OOP方法。

html - <head> 标签是不是默认不显示的常规标签

我在浏览Chrome中的网页时注意到标签有CSS{display:none;}已分配。这让我开始思考,是标记只是浏览器决定不显示的常规标记尽管这没有明显用处,但我可以改用吗?标记代替标记并使用css"cheese{display:none;}",实现与相同的功能标签? 最佳答案 和display:none是的,标签是一个常规标签,就像任何其他标签一样,默认用户代理样式表具有display:none;应用于它。我很酷,你可以用它来证明这是为了展示你的风格:jsFiddlehead,style{display:block;}为了获得更多

html - 在 cookie 中存储 OAuth token 是不好的做法吗?

在cookie中存储OAuth2token是否是一种不好的做法?如果是这样,网络应用程序的替代方案是什么? 最佳答案 是否可以将access_token存储在cookie中取决于以下几点:存储在cookie中的access_token是否加密(绝对应该加密)Access_token是一个不记名token,因此它不依赖于浏览器流。Cookie通常用于维护浏览器中的状态。因此,如果token的生命周期与cookie相同,则继续,否则不继续。当我说生命周期时,我指的是生命周期等。此外,请考虑访问token不是身份token这一事实Acce

html - 是不是AppCache = Application Cache = Web Storage的LocalStorage?

我对HTML5离线存储的(各种)术语感到有点困惑。我认为AppCache是WebStorage的另一个名称,您可以通过缓存list指定离线存储的内容。并且有两种类型:LocalStorage(在当前session之后持续存在)和session存储(在当前session之后不持续存在)。以上是我从W3C和维基百科读到的内容,但HeadFirstHTML5Programming(Freeman&Robinson)深入描述了LocalStorage,然后在附录中有WebStorage(包含关于缓存list的信息)(“thingsweare'覆盖)。我理解正确吗?

javascript - 在 HTML 中使用内联事件处理程序是不好的做法吗?

按照目前的情况,这个问题不适合我们的问答形式。我们希望答案得到事实、引用或专业知识的支持,但这个问题可能会引发辩论、争论、投票或扩展讨论。如果您觉得这个问题可以改进并可能重新打开,visitthehelpcenter指导。关闭9年前。使用内联JavaScript事件处理程序不好吗?在我打算使用它的页面上,我只打算使用一次事件处理程序,所以在这种情况下使用内联事件处理程序是否可以接受,或者我应该在其中编写事件处理程序的代码标签?

javascript - 使用非标准的 HTML 属性是否被认为是不好的做法?

这个问题在这里已经有了答案:Non-StandardAttributesonHTMLTags.GoodThing?BadThing?YourThoughts?(9个回答)关闭8年前。我发现设置任意属性非常方便,例如:...在JavaScript中:varsoId=$selectofA.attr('stackoverflowId');//jQuery这是一个好的做法吗?我从来没有遇到过这个问题。

javascript - 在 HTML5 中使用自定义元素是不好的做法吗?

这个问题在这里已经有了答案:ArecustomelementsvalidHTML5?(12个答案)关闭9年前。使用document.getElementByTagName之类的东西,您几乎可以创建自己的元素。Hello然后在JS中..vara=document.getElementsByTagName("arial");for(i=0;i我们有一个自定义元素,很简单。我的问题归结为,这是不好的做法吗?有什么我没有注意到的缺点吗?

html - 在 html 中显示表单时使用表格标签是不是糟糕的设计?

我一直听说div标签应该用于布局目的而不是table标签。那么这也适用于表单布局吗?我知道表单布局仍然是布局,但使用div创建表单布局似乎需要更多html和css。因此,考虑到这一点,表单布局是否应该改用div标签? 最佳答案 是的,它确实适用于表单布局。请记住,还有像FIELDSET和LABEL这样​​的标签专门用于向表单添加结构,因此这并不是仅使用DIV的问题。您应该能够用极少的HTML标记表单,然后让CSS完成其余工作。例如:Name:... 关于html-在html中显示表单时使